Similar PR to #193. These changes are based on the code that from https://github.com/openshift/mysql, but it does not include some recent changes in the scripts. Even if the image is meant to work in OpenShift, it doesn't mean that it shouldn't work outside of OpenShift -- the opposite is true, the image should be usable on Atomic or normal Fedora Server/Workstation/Cloud without any issues as well.
